Fit and Size Matter Most
One of the biggest lessons I learned is that cuff size matters a lot. If the cuff is too tight or too loose, the reading may not be accurate. I always measure my upper arm before buying and compare it with the product’s size range. For me, choosing the right fit gives me more confidence in every reading.
Compatibility With My Monitor
I never assume a cuff will work with every blood pressure monitor. I always check the model compatibility first. The Lifesource Blood Pressure Cuff is best when it matches the correct monitor series, so I make sure to confirm that before ordering. That simple step saves me from returns and frustration.
